- Scientific name: Athenaea martiana
- Family: Solanaceae
- Native range: Southern America
Taxonomical Classification
This plant belongs to the kingdom Plantae and the phylum Streptophyta, falling under the class Equisetopsida and subclass Magnoliidae. Within the order Solanales, it is classified under the family Solanaceae. Finally, it is identified by the genus Athenaea, specifically as the species Athenaea martiana.

Distribution
This plant is found within a specific and limited range in South America. Its primary geographical presence is concentrated within the country of Brazil. More specifically, its occurrence is localized to the Southeast region of this nation. Chemicals
Athenaea martiana has 5 reported phytochemicals identified across 5 scientific publications and several other databases. The most consistently reported chemicals include 4-hydroxybenzoic acid, caffeic acid, ferulic acid, protocatechuic acid, vanillic acid.
